Verizon offers (sometimes for no charge) the Askey 4G LTE Network Extender to alleviate in-home signal issues.   It connects via ethernet to a broadband (not fiber nor satellite) internet connection to get to the Verizon Wireless network.  It provides a local 4G cell signal.  The question is whether your model iPhone software can connect to it successfully, consistently.  You should search this Forum for 'iPhone issues with LTE network extender'.
